Final Fantasy: The 4 Heroes of Light

2009 · Nintendo DS · the direct ancestor of Bravely Default

Final Fantasy: The 4 Heroes of Light is a storybook RPG with a hard edge: no party-wide targeting, a single shared item pool, and a crown system that changes each character’s class. Its design team went on to make Bravely Default, and the lineage is obvious in everything from the job structure to the art.

Brandt, Jusqua, Yunita and Aire begin the game separated and spend much of it working alone or in pairs, which is unusual for a four-hero structure and gives each of them a genuine arc rather than a role.

The crowns are the reason job data here needs care: a character can wear any of them, so the puzzles file each one under the class the story associates with them rather than whatever they can equip.
